TOPXCDZ H807SB 4-Port DMX/Artnet to SPI LED Pixel Controller User Manual

1. Introduction

The TOPXCDZ H807SB is a versatile LED pixel controller featuring WIFI and Bluetooth remote control capabilities. This V3 version supports four output ports, capable of controlling up to 4096 pixels. It operates with a DC5-24V input voltage and offers control via Android mobile applications, web pages across various operating systems, and wireless synchronization for multiple controllers. It also supports wireless control from a DMA console.

The H807SB facilitates communication distances of over 60 meters (unobstructed) between controllers or between a controller and a mobile phone. Bluetooth remote control communication is effective over 30 meters (unobstructed). This controller is compatible with a wide range of LED driver chips, including DMX512, HDMX, MY9941, UCS1903, UCS1909, UCS1912, WS2811, WS2812, WS2813, TM1809, TM1812, TM1913, TM1926, P943, P9883, SM16703, SM16709, and SM16712. For optimal performance, the control effect and timing for specific driver chips should be verified through actual testing. The recommended software for programming is "LED Programming Software" V5.03 or newer. Please note that the Bluetooth remote control is an optional accessory and must be purchased separately.

2. Product Overview

The H807SB controller is designed for advanced LED pixel control, offering robust features for various lighting applications.

Key Features:

  • Four Output Ports: Controls up to 4096 pixels.
  • SD Card Support: Compatible with FAT32 and FAT16 formats, supporting up to 64 DAT files.
  • Mobile App Control: Use your phone to switch files, adjust speed and brightness, and configure unicast or full playback settings.
  • WIFI Connectivity: Supports various WIFI working modes and WEB control. Enables multiple controllers to synchronize wirelessly.
  • DMA Console Integration: Connects to DMA consoles via WIFI, supports RGBW, allows file replacement, and speed/brightness adjustments with fast response times.
  • Pixel Tracing and Counting: Supports online point tracing and offline point counting.
  • DAT File Management: Receive and save DAT files to the SD card via WIFI.
  • Firmware Upgrades: Supports firmware updates for enhanced functionality.
  • Bluetooth Remote Control: Compatible with Bluetooth remote control (sold separately).

3.2 Power Connection

  1. Ensure the power supply is within the DC5-24V range.
  2. Connect the positive (+) terminal of your power supply to the "POWER 5-24V" input on the controller.
  3. Connect the negative (-) terminal (GND) of your power supply to the "POWER GND" input on the controller.
  4. Verify all connections are secure before applying power.

3.3 LED Strip Connection

The H807SB features four output ports for connecting LED pixel strips.

  1. Identify the Data (DAT/D) and Ground (GND) wires on your LED pixel strip.
  2. Connect the Data wire of your LED strip to the "DAT/D" terminal of an available output port (Port 1, 2, 3, or 4) on the controller.
  3. Connect the Ground wire of your LED strip to the "GND" terminal of the same output port.
  4. Repeat for additional LED strips, utilizing the remaining ports as needed.
  5. Ensure the LED strip's voltage matches the controller's output voltage (which is determined by the input power supply).

3.4 SD Card Insertion

  1. Format your SD card to FAT32 or FAT16 file system.
  2. Load your desired DAT files (up to 64) onto the formatted SD card.
  3. Locate the SD card slot on the side of the H807SB controller (refer to Figure 2).
  4. Insert the SD card into the slot until it clicks into place.

6. Troubleshooting

Common Issues and Solutions:

  • Controller does not power on:
    • Check power supply connections and ensure the input voltage is within DC5-24V.
    • Verify the power adapter is functioning correctly.
  • LED strips are not lighting up or displaying incorrect patterns:
    • Ensure DAT/D and GND connections to the LED strips are correct and secure.
    • Verify the LED driver chip type selected in the software matches your LED strips.
    • Check if the correct DAT file is loaded and playing.
    • Confirm the number of pixels set in the software matches your physical LED strip length.
    • Ensure the LED strip itself is functional.
  • Cannot connect to controller via WIFI/App:
    • Ensure the controller is powered on and its WIFI is active.
    • Check your device's WIFI settings and confirm it's connected to the controller's network.
    • Restart both the controller and your device.
    • Verify the mobile app or web interface is up-to-date.
  • SD card not recognized or DAT files not playing:
    • Ensure the SD card is properly inserted into the slot.
    • Verify the SD card is formatted to FAT32 or FAT16.
    • Check that the DAT files are correctly placed on the SD card and are not corrupted.
    • Try using a different SD card to rule out card issues.
  • Bluetooth remote control not working:
    • Ensure the remote has fresh batteries.
    • Confirm the remote is properly paired with the controller.
    • Check the communication distance; ensure it's within 30 meters (unobstructed).

7. Specifications

FeatureDetail
ModelH807SB
Input VoltageDC5-24V
Output Ports4 ports
Max Control Pixels4096 pixels
ConnectivityWIFI, Bluetooth
Supported LED Driver ChipsDMX512, HDMX, MY9941, UCS1903, UCS1909, UCS1912, WS2811, WS2812, WS2813, TM1809, TM1812, TM1913, TM1926, P943, P9883, SM16703, SM16709, SM16712, etc.
SD Card SupportFAT32, FAT16 (up to 64 DAT files)
Software"LED Programming Software" V5.03 and above
WIFI Communication Distance>60 meters (unobstructed)
Bluetooth Communication Distance>30 meters (unobstructed)
MaterialPlastic
Indoor/Outdoor UsageIndoor
Included ComponentsLED Controller, SD Card
